Wall control blasting practices at the Ekati~(TM) diamond mine

摘要

A review of blast designs and improved blasting practices at the Ekati~(TM) diamond mine is presented along with the results of three blast-monitoring experiments. Blast monitoring was undertaken to investigate blast damage mechanisms in the mine's well jointed rock mass. Rock mass damage caused by production, pre-shear and wall control blasts was measured. Ekati~(TM) uses 270mm holes for production blasting, and 165mm holes loaded with a decoupled charge for pre-shearing. The production blasts are loaded with bulk emulsion/ANFO blends. The mine plan involves using 30m double benches. A 30m high pre-shear is drilled and blasted prior to the production blasting that is done with sequential 15m benches. This paper summarizes the monitoring equipment and data gathered to date.
